Leadership Review Briefing — Project Larkspur Delay

Project Larkspur, Denholm Foods' warehouse management rollout, is now four months behind schedule due to vendor integration failures. Revised completion is set for the second quarter of next year. Finance should note an overspend of roughly 12%, absorbed within the operations contingency. No external reporting impact is expected. Strategic implications are summarised below.

management briefing: Project Ulavan slips by two quarters because of the staffing delay.

### Meeting Notes — Canary Gating (Mistral Deploy Platform)

Agreed: canaries hold at 10% for 20 minutes; auto-rollback on error rate above 1% or latency regression past 15%. No weekend promotions without on-call confirmation. Gating thresholds are frozen until next quarter's review. Final authority on promotion overrides rests with the person named below.

named custodian: Oliath Ralax

**Key Ceremony Checklist — Item 7: Timezone Verification**

Before signing the export keys for Marlowe Reports, confirm that all report timestamps render in the customer's configured timezone, not server UTC. Run the export twice across a DST boundary date and compare. Once both exports match, the ceremony custodian will ask you to read the recovery passphrase aloud for witness confirmation. It is recorded below.

unlock words, bagag-kajef: zormir-jorath-tammir-oliius-briix-norys

Minutes — Management Meeting, Ferncliff Hospitality

Attendees: the usual management crew. Main item: next year's training budget. Good discussion — consensus landed on a 12% uplift, mostly for the Hearthline service programme and first-aid renewals. Deck for the board goes out Friday; branch-level splits to follow. Sal flagged we should tie this to wider plans, so the confidential context is added directly below.

board note of bajop-yaweg: The western region missed its Pelys quota by 58.0 percent last quarter. Pelysek Foods plans to raise the Belius list price by 44.0 percent in July. The steering committee signed off on a budget of $133.8 million for Project Pelax. The renewal with Zoraelix Systems closes at $61.9 million a year, 12.7 percent above the last contract.